The standard Capital Asset Pricing Model (CAPM) is simple, intuitive, and grounded in sound economic theory. Yet, almost half a century's worth of empirical testing has so far failed to demonstrate its relevance. One major reason given for the CAPM's empirical failure is that beta is not the sole measure of systematic risk. In other words, the standard CAPM does not hold. Another important explanation is that the CAPM may hold conditionally rather than unconditionally. The standard CAPM fails to explain the cross-section of returns because it ignores the fact that both the risk and the price of risk are time-varying. The search for conditional models has led researchers to either disregard the theory behind the CAPM or to use statistical procedures that are too complex to be replicated by other researchers and practitioners. In this paper we propose a conditional model that is compatible with the standard CAPM while remaining simple and accessible to both researchers and practitioners. Beta and the risk premium are assumed to be time-varying, with the latter being associated with bull and bear states. We find strong support for the conditional CAPM with beta explaining both bull and bear markets. While the bear market ex-post risk premium is negative, the weighted average risk premium is positive and highly significant.  相似文献

Distributional properties of emerging market returns may impact on investor ability and willingness to diversify. Investors may also place greater weighting on downside losses, compared to upside gains. Using individual equities in a range of emerging Asian markets, we investigate the potential contribution of downside risk measures to explain asset pricing in these markets. As realized returns are used as a proxy for expected returns, we separately examine conditional returns in upturn and downturn periods, in order to successfully identify risk and return relationships. Results indicate that co-skewness and downside beta are priced by investors. Further testing confirms a separate premium for each measure, confirming that they capture different aspects of downside risk. Robustness tests indicate that, when combined with other risk measures, both retain their explanatory power. Tests also indicate that co-skewness may be the more robust measure.  相似文献

A number of studies have found that the cross-section of stock returns reflects a risk premium for bearing downside beta; however, existing measures of downside beta have poor power for predicting returns. This paper proposes a novel measure of downside beta, the ES-implied beta, to improve the prediction of the cross-section of asset returns. The ES-implied beta explains stock returns over the same period as well as the widely used downside beta, but improves the prediction for future returns due to its high persistence. In the empirical analysis, the widely used downside beta shows a weak relation with future expected returns, but the ES-implied beta implies a statistically and economically significant risk premium of 0.6% per month and explains 0.6% of the variation in the cross-sectional returns. The effect cannot be explained by traditional cross-sectional effects and is different from the CAPM beta, the downside beta in Ang et al. (2006), coskewness, and cokurtosis.  相似文献

In this paper, the authors employ a nonlinear formulation to examine empirically the structural content of the three moment capital asset pricing model (CAPM). Whereas previous research focused on the coefficients of beta and co-skewness, this paper presents empirical results on the market risk premium and elasticity coefficient components of these two coefficients. The results indicate that although the estimated coefficient of coskewness gives important information on the marginal rate of substitution between skewness and expected return, the elasticity coefficient can provide additional (albeit different) information on skewness preference that is independent of the effects of the market risk premium. This research also shows how the non-linear formulation provides a direct linkage between the twomoment and three-moment CAPM versions and thus provides an empirical test of the theoretical conditions under which skewness preference is consistent with the two-moment CAPM empiricial results.  相似文献

This article proposes a theoretical testable capital asset pricing model for partially segmented markets. We establish that if some investors do not hold all international assets because of direct and/or indirect barriers, the world market portfolio is not efficient and the traditional international CAPM must be augmented by a new factor reflecting the local risk undiversifiable internationally. We also introduce a suitable framework to test this model empirically. Using a sample of six emerging markets and three mature markets, we find that the degree of stock market integration varies through time and that most of the sample emerging markets have become more integrated in the recent years. The local risk premium for emerging markets represents the most important component of the total risk premium, but its relative importance has decreased recently. Differently, the total risk premium for developed countries is largely driven by global factors.  相似文献

Using Spanish stock market data, this paper examines volatility spillovers between large and small firms and their impact on expected returns. By using a conditional capital asset pricing model (CAPM) with an asymmetric multivariate GARCH-M covariance structure, it is shown that there exist bidirectional volatility spillovers between both types of companies, especially after bad news. After estimating the model, a positive and significant price of risk is obtained. This result is consistent with the volatility feedback effect, one of the most popular explanations of the asymmetric volatility phenomenon, and explains why risk premiums are much more sensitive to negative return shocks coming from the whole market or other related markets.  相似文献

This paper proposes a general framework for the pricing of capital assets in a multiperiod world. Under quite general conditions, the analysis shows that the equilibrium expected nominal return on any asset can always be expressed as the sum of the risk-free rate and various risk premiums. The first risk premium is identical to the usual risk premium in the Sharpe-Lintner-Mossin capital asset pricing model. The mathematical forms of all the remaining risk premiums are identical even though each individual risk premium may be present for a different reason.  相似文献

When the assumption of constant risk premiums is relaxed, financial valuation models may be tested, and risk measures estimated without specifying a market index or state variables. This is accomplished by examining the behavior of conditional expected returns. The approach is developed using a single risk premium asset pricing model as an example and then extended to models with multiple risk premiums. The methodology is illustrated using daily return data on the common stocks of the Dow Jones 30. The tests indicate that these returns are consistent with a single, time-varying risk premium.  相似文献

Between 1954 and 1991, U.S. stocks, long-term government bonds, and corporate bonds show negative risk premiums during periods preceded by inverted yield curves. Intermediate-term government bonds do not. Going from safer to riskier asset classes, the negative risk premiums increase in absolute value and statistical significance. The consumption CAPM offers a possible explanation for the negative risk premiums. A negative covariance between the growth rate of consumption and the premium on the risky assets will result in a negative risk premium. Empirical tests of the conditional covariance show that the consumption CAPM does not explain the phenomena.  相似文献

This paper offers an alternative method for estimating expected returns. The proposed reward beta approach performs well empirically and is based on asset pricing theory. The empirical section compares this approach with the capital asset pricing model (CAPM) and the Fama–French three‐factor model. In out‐of‐sample testing, both the CAPM and the three‐factor model are rejected. In contrast, the reward beta approach easily passes the same test. In robustness checks, the reward beta approach consistently outperforms both the CAPM and the three‐factor model.  相似文献

Significant firm-size-related differences in abnormal returns and systematic risks occur in bull and bear market months from 1926 to 1988. Potential differential return premiums between recessions and expansions appear to be captured by the varying risk model and not the constant risk model. Using a dual-beta market model to adjust for risk differences in bull and bear markets, we find that large firm stocks on average earn significant positive excess returns and small firm stocks earn significant negative excess returns. Superior performance of large firm stocks is even more pronounced outside January.  相似文献

This study examines the cross‐sectional variation of futures returns from different asset classes. The monthly returns are positively correlated with downside risk and negatively correlated with coskewness. The asymmetric volatility effect generates negatively skewed returns. Assets with high coskewness and low downside betas provide hedges against market downside risk and offer low returns. The high returns offered by assets with low coskewness and high downside betas are a risk premium for bearing downside risk. The asset pricing model that incorporates downside risk partially explains the futures returns. The results indicate a unified risk perspective to jointly price different asset classes.  相似文献

Differences in excess stock returns can be rationalized by their sensitivities to conditional interest rate risk. Value stocks are particularly sensitive to upside movements in interest rate growth, while growth stocks react strongly to downside movements in interest rate growth. Consistent with the basic asset pricing theory, the upside interest rate risk commands a negative premium which is higher than the premium associated with the downside interest rate risk. Upside beta pertains its explanatory power after controlling for exposure to regular unconditional interest rate and various sources of financial and conditional macroeconomic risk.  相似文献

Motivated by the asset pricing theory with safety-first preference, we introduce and operationalize a conditional extreme risk (CER) measure to describe expected stock performance conditional on a small-probability market downturn (black swan). We document a significant CER premium in the cross-section of expected returns. We also demonstrate that CER explains the premia to downside beta, coskewness, and cokurtosis. CER provides distinct information regarding black swan hedging that cannot be captured by co-crash-based tail dependence measures. As we find that the pricing effect is stronger among black swan hedging stocks, this distinction helps explain the absence of premium to tail dependence.  相似文献

I present a new hindcast stock market index for the United States over the twentieth century. This is constructed by calibrating a rational asset pricing model that allows for a time‐varying equity premium driven by heteroskedasticity in consumption growth. By incorporating this variation in risk, the mean square error of the generated index series, when compared to the observed levels of the S&P 500, is significantly reduced. The model also explains the broad magnitudes and timings of the major bull and bear markets of the twentieth century, particularly before 1973, and the excess volatility puzzle is largely resolved.  相似文献

One explanation for the high real interest rates on Treasury bills during the period from 1980 to 1985 is that the risk premium had risen. A procedure for testing this hypothesis is to apply the Black version of the capital asset pricing model to real Treasury bill returns. This paper examines that procedure in detail. The main conclusion is that nonstationarity and measurement error, which are always impediments to empirical implementation of the CAPM, are particularly difficult to handle when estimating changes in Treasury bill risk premiums. Furthermore, the behavior of the premium depends on the index used to measure inflation.  相似文献

Prior studies find that a strategy that buys high‐beta stocks and sells low‐beta stocks has a significantly negative unconditional capital asset pricing model (CAPM) alpha, such that it appears to pay to “bet against beta.” We show, however, that the conditional beta for the high‐minus‐low beta portfolio covaries negatively with the equity premium and positively with market volatility. As a result, the unconditional alpha is a downward‐biased estimate of the true alpha. We model the conditional market risk for beta‐sorted portfolios using instrumental variables methods and find that the conditional CAPM resolves the beta anomaly.  相似文献

Conditional asset pricing models have been used to determine whether the value premium and other CAPM anomalies are due to risk. We show that the conclusions on whether these anomalies are due to risk are very sensitive to the choice of the information variables used to define good and bad states of the world. We use a conditional CAPM framework allowing for alternative sets of plausible conditioning information and find that value appears to be riskier than growth in only about ten to twenty percent of specifications. We find even less evidence that size, issuance, momentum, and asset growth portfolio returns are due to risk. Overall, our results suggest that common CAPM anomalies are not due to risk.  相似文献

We analyze the impact of both purchasing power parity (PPP) deviations and market segmentation on asset pricing and investor's portfolio holdings. The freely traded securities command a world market risk premium and an inflation risk premium. The securities that can be held by only a subset of investors command two additional premiums: a conditional market risk premium and a segflation risk premium. Our model is empirically supported with important implications for tests of international asset pricing.  相似文献

An extensive empirical literature finds that micro asset markets are segmented from one another. We develop a consumption-based asset pricing model to quantify the aggregate implications of a financial system comprised of many such segmented micro asset markets. We specify exogenously the level of segmentation that determines how much idiosyncratic risk traders bear in their micro market and calibrate the segmentation to match facts about systematic and idiosyncratic return volatility. In our benchmark model traders bear 30% of their idiosyncratic risk, the unconditional aggregate equity premium is 2.4% annual, and the welfare costs of segmentation are substantial, 1.8% of lifetime consumption.  相似文献
